It is aimed to guide people in farming in the city. It is intended to increase food production, reduce the volume of solid waste, prevent malnutrition, promote strong family relationships and reintroduce love of nature and the practice of ecological balance in urban living.
Contents: Container farming. Growing crops in the city. Picture gallery of landscapes. Programs of urban agriculture. Vegetable recipes. Companion planting guide. Organic insect sprays. Directory of different suppliers of seeds, agricultural chemicals, tools and plant containers. Selected references and index.
